Export (0) Print
Expand All

GetPersonInfo Method (String, Guid, HealthServiceInstance)

HealthVault
Gets the authenticated person's information using the specified authentication token, from the specified HealthVault web-service instance.

Namespace: Microsoft.Health.Web
Assembly: Microsoft.Health.Web (in Microsoft.Health.Web.dll) Version: 2.1.0.0 (1.15.1003.9505)

public static PersonInfo GetPersonInfo(
	string authToken,
	Guid appId,
	HealthServiceInstance serviceInstance
)

Parameters

authToken
Type: System..::..String
The authentication token for a user. This can be retrieved by extracting the WCToken query string parameter from the request after the user has been redirected to the HealthVault AUTH page. See RedirectToShellUrl(HttpContext, String) for more information.
appId
Type: System..::..Guid
The unique identifier for the application.
serviceInstance
Type: Microsoft.Health..::..HealthServiceInstance
The HealthVault web-service instance.

Return Value

The information about the logged in person.

Applications that work with more than one HealthVault instance should not call this method. Instead, call the overload which takes an HealthServiceInstance, specifying the HealthVault instance where the session auth token was created.
Show:
© 2014 Microsoft